Why These Are the Top HVAC Contractors in Henning

Henning's HVAC market is characterized by high demand for reliable heating systems due to Minnesota's severe winters, where temperatures regularly drop below 0°F. The summer months bring humidity concerns, creating demand for efficient AC systems. Most homes in this area use forced-air furnaces, with growing interest in energy-efficient upgrades due to rising fuel costs. The market consists primarily of local, family-owned businesses with deep knowledge of aging housing stock and regional climate challenges. Emergency service capability is particularly valued during winter months when system failures can be dangerous.

Frequently Asked Questions About HVAC in Henning

Get answers to common questions about hvac services in Henning, Minnesota.

1What is the best time of year to replace my furnace or air conditioner in Henning?

For furnace replacement, late summer or early fall (August-September) is ideal, as local HVAC companies are less busy than during the first cold snap. For air conditioning, early spring (April-May) is best to ensure your system is ready for Otter Tail County's humid summer heat. Scheduling during these off-peak times often leads to better availability, quicker installation, and potential promotional pricing from local providers.

2How does Henning's climate affect the type of HVAC system I should choose?

Henning experiences extreme seasonal swings, with very cold, long winters and warm, humid summers. This demands a high-efficiency furnace (90% AFUE or higher) for fuel economy and a reliable air conditioner with good dehumidification. Given the climate, investing in a properly sized heat pump as a dual-fuel option with your furnace is becoming a popular local choice for efficient heating during milder winter periods and cooling in summer.

3Are there any local rebates or regulations for HVAC upgrades in Minnesota that apply to Henning homeowners?

Yes. While there are no specific Henning city ordinances, all installations must follow Minnesota's mechanical and fuel gas codes. Importantly, homeowners should check for rebates from their local utility, such as Otter Tail Power Company, which often offers incentives for high-efficiency furnaces, air conditioners, and heat pumps. Additionally, federal tax credits for qualified energy-efficient systems are available and can provide significant savings.

4What should I look for when choosing a local HVAC contractor in the Henning area?

Prioritize contractors who are licensed, insured, and have a physical local presence for reliable emergency service during a winter storm. Look for proven experience with the harsh Minnesota climate and ask for references from nearby homes. A reputable provider will perform a detailed Manual J load calculation specific to your home's construction and insulation to ensure proper system sizing, which is critical for efficiency and comfort here.

5My furnace is old but still working. Should I wait for it to fail completely, or replace it proactively?

Proactive replacement is highly recommended in Henning. Waiting for a failure in January can leave you without heat in sub-zero temperatures, leading to emergency service premiums and potential frozen pipes. If your furnace is over 15 years old, scheduling a replacement in the off-season ensures you get the best price, have time to research options, and avoid the risk and discomfort of a sudden breakdown during our severe winter.
